How to Frost a Cake

Cool cake layers in pans on wire rack for 5 minutes.
Cover another rack with a towel; place towel side down on top of layer and invert as a unit. Remove pan.
Place original rack on bottom of layer; turn over both racks (as a unit) so layer is right side up.
Repeat with other layer. Allow layers to cool completely.
Before frosting cake, brush loose crumbs from sides and edges of cooled layers. Support cake firmly with one hand and brush crumbs with the other.
Place one layer, rounded side down, on cake plate, spread about 1/2 cup of frosting to within 1/4 inch of edge.
Place second layer, rounded side up, on frosted layer. Coat side with very thin layer of frosting to seal in crumbs.
Swirl more frosting on side, forming a 1/4-inch ridge above top of cake.
Spread remaining frosting over top of cake, just meeting the built-up ridge around side. Make attractive swirls or leave the top smooth for decorations.

The line that contains consonance is In shanties by the sides of roads.

Consonance is a stylistic literary device recognized through the repetition of identical or similar consonants in neighboring phrases whose vowel sounds are unique. Consonance may be regarded as the counterpart to the vowel-sound repetition referred to as assonance.

The noun consonance refers to a kingdom of settlement or concord of components, and it frequently refers to a pleasant combination of musical sounds. In its musical sense, the alternative to consonance is dissonance.

Assonance and consonance are varieties of repetition in which a valid is repeated. Assonance is the repetition of a vowel sound. for example, Jan likes to devour junk mail from a can. observe the repetition of the fast 'a' vowel sound. Consonance is the repetition of a steady sound.

Use a semicolon to join two related independent clauses in place of a comma and a coordinating conjunction (and, but, or, nor, for, so, yet). Here's an example: I have a big test tomorrow; I can't go out tonight. The two clauses in that sentence are separated by a semicolon and could be sentences on their own if you put a period between them instead: I have a big test tomorrow. I can't go out tonight.

A subordinate clause or dependent clause is a clause that can’t exist as a sentence on its own. Like all clauses, it has a subject and a predicate, but it doesn’t share a complete thought. A subordinate clause only gives extra information and is “dependent” on other words to make a full sentence.

What is Macbeth?

Shakespeare's Macbeth, a tragedy in five acts that was written sometime between 1606-07 and was first printed in the First Folio in 1623, was either adapted from a playbook or a playscript.

The published edition contains several missing or distorted passages from the original text. There are no side stories or subplots, making it the shortest of Shakespeare's plays.

It details Macbeth's ascent to power and subsequent demise, both of which were fueled by his obstinate desire. Macbeth encounters the Weird Sisters on the scorched heath; John Gilbert's title page for a Shakespearean works edition, 1858–1860.

Generals working for King Duncan of Scotland, Macbeth and Banquo encounter the Weird Sisters, three witches who foretell Macbeth's future as thane of Cawdor and eventual throne, as well as Banquo's progeny bearing kings.

Soon after, Macbeth learns that he has actually been elevated to the position of Thane of Cawdor, which encourages him to accept the rest of the prophecy.

The Canterbury Tales, which Geoffrey Chaucer wrote, is his best-known work as a poet, author, and public official in England. He has been referred to as either the "father of English poetry" or the "father of English literature."

Geoffrey Chaucer, often referred to be the father of English poetry, created an intriguing work of art called "The Canterbury Tales: General Prologue." It provides the poem with a structure and provides a glimpse into life in Renaissance England. This was based on Boccaccio's Decameron, but Chaucer's sincere humour and humanity gave it additional depth.

The Prologue of Chaucer begins with a description of spring. On a spring evening, he and other pilgrims met at the Tabard Inn in Southwark, the starting and finishing point for the journeys to the Canterbury shrine of St. Thomas Becket. He gathers a group of pilgrims that encompasses all facets of fourteenth-century English society. There are 32 pilgrims altogether, including the poet. The owner of the Tabard Inn suggests that each of them share two stories about their journeys to Canterbury and back after dinner. They enthusiastically agreed and left the following morning at the crack of dawn. It is also determined that the winner of the contest would receive a delectable meal, and the host will accompany the contestants on their journey and serve as the tales' judge.
